Pre-Registration Now Open for Rogue, the Roguelite Card-Based JRPG on Android
Kemco has just opened pre-registration for their latest card-based JRPG, *Novel Rogue*, now available for sign-ups on Android and Steam. Dive into a world of enchanting pixel-art visuals as you step into the shoes of a young apprentice learning the art of magic under the guidance of the Witch of Portals. As you delve deeper into the magical realm, you'll uncover enchanted tomes within the Ancient Library, each brimming with unique adventures waiting to be explored.
In *Novel Rogue*, you'll engage in turn-based battles where you can craft and customize your deck. The game introduces roguelite elements that add an extra layer of excitement and unpredictability to your gameplay experience. With four distinct tomes at your disposal, each offering a different combat system, you have the freedom to strategize and tailor your deck to unleash powerful magic that aligns perfectly with your preferred playstyle. The charming pixel-art visuals enhance the nostalgic feel of this magical journey.

As with many of Kemco's RPGs, *Novel Rogue* offers both a freemium and a premium version. The freemium version allows you to play for free with ads, which can be removed with a single purchase. The premium version, on the other hand, is ad-free and comes with an additional 150 Witch Stones. Keep in mind, data cannot be transferred between the two versions, so choose wisely.
